| GISCO is proud to introduce the DMT 24 bit SUMMIT
Compact Unit (SCU) for seismic exploration. Likely seismic techniques
include very high resolution tomography, vertical seismic profiling, shallow
reflection/refraction and deep seismic sounding for various applications,
such as engineering seismology and environmental surveys. For Vibroseis
application the correlation with diversity stacking is performed within
the SCU. One SCU handles 12 or 24 seismic input channels. Up to 1200 channels (50 SCUs) can be linked to a central control PC via a simple two wire cable. By using repeaters each 330 m the maximum cable length is unlimited. The SCUs can be linked to the transmission cable at any position. SCUs and SUMMIT 2 channel Remote Units can be combined on the same line. Each channel consists of a preamplifier, an analog High-Cut Filter, an A/D-Converter and a high performance 24 bit Digital Signal Processor. This circuit allows high speed data conversion, digital filtering and has a dynamic range of more than 120 dB. The data are sampled with high frequency and reduced to the desired sample frequency using over-sampling technique, with improves system resolution. The control PC provides QC functions, data acquisition software, as well as plot facilities and final data storage on various PC controlled devices (disc, 9track, DAT, etc.) in standard SEG format. Built in test functions include: sine test, pulse, instrument noise, geophone step, sweep transfer, autocorrelation, battery status, distortion, dynamic range, common mode rejection, cross talk, timming accuracy, geophone impedance, damping, leakage, natural frequency, and noise.. |

Specifications:
Number of Channels per Unit: ...... 12 or 24 Maximum Number of Channels: ... 1200 Sample Interval: ........................... 1/32, 1/16, ..., 8 ms Number of Samples per Trace: ..... 512, 1K, 2K,.. 16K in vib mode, 48k dynamite mode Maximum Input Signal: ................. 2 Vrms System Input Noise: ....................... 0.3 uvrms @ 2 ms sample rate Dynamic Range: ............................ 120 dB @ 2 ms System Resolution: ........................ 24 bits @ 2 ms Preamplification: ........................... 0 or 18db Gain Accuracy between Channels: .better than 1 % Input Impedance: ........................... 20K ohms Common Mode Rejection Ratio: ... > 100 dB Total Harmonic Distortion: ............ <0.0008 % Low Cut filter analog: .................... 1Hz @6db/octive Alias filter analog: ......................... 7.2kHz @6 dB/oct Alias Filter digital: ......................... -120 dB rejection at Nyquist freq. ....................................................... Passband ripple <+/- 0.5db ....................................................... -6db 12.8kHz @ 1/32 ms sample rate down to ....................................................... 50Hz @ 8ms sample rate Crosstalk: ...................................... > 114 dB Data Format: ................................. 24 bit fixed point Weight: ......................................... 7.5 kg Dimensions: .................................. 1 9 x 19 x 35 cm Power Supply: .............................. +12 VDC @ 0.4 W/channel Operation Temperature Range: .....-30 C to +80 C, 0 - 100% humidity Typical shot cycle time: ................ 10 seconds for 2k samples, 1ms sample rate, ...................................................... 256 channels, including data storage |
